2. There is also a Bug situation: this App that can't be connected to the Internet can't be found in the list.
1) At this time, select any App in the list, close "WLAN and Cellular Mobile Data" first, that is, data is not allowed to be used, and then reopen "WLAN and Cellular Mobile Data".
2) Return to the desktop and open the App that cannot be connected to the Internet again. At this point, the system will prompt "Whether to allow the App to use the data network", and click "Allow" to successfully connect the App to the network.
Finally, there is an ultimate solution. Enter "Settings-Cellular Mobile Network", open "WLAN Assistant", then open the app, and select OK when the window pops up.
